Peacock Spots In Miami-Broward

Featured Replies

I'd like to make this thread to help out everyone targeting Peacock. Just share your spots and we will all be happy. :)

My spots:

-Canal alongside the Palmetto next to Don Shula's Gold Course, connects to another canal that goes west towards I-75

-C.B. Smith Park

-Griffin near I-75

-Vista View Park

-Griffin and 441

-Miami International Airport Lakes (Blue Lagoon)

-All canals connected to Blue Lagoon

-Flamingo and Sterling Canal

-Almost all lakes in private neighborhoods in Miramar/Pembroke Pines

-C100

-C1

-C-14

-Fountainbleau and 97th Avenue

Most of the canals/lakes in Miramar and Pembroke Pines have Peacock.
